The Medication Aide course is for Nursing Assistants who are seeking to enhance their career opportunities by becoming certified medication aides.
The Qualified Medication Aide class at Healthcare Career Centers, Inc. , located in Austin, Texas, is designed to provide students with the knowledge and skills necessary to safely and effectively administer medications to patients in a variety of healthcare settings. The course covers topics such as medication administration, medication safety, and medication storage. Students will also learn about the legal and ethical considerations of medication administration, as well as the importance of patient education and communication.
A Qualified Medication Aide (QMA) is a Certified Nursing Assistant (CNA) who has completed more training in order to be able to give medication to patients. QMA programs require that you already have your CNA license and may have additional requirements on top of that.
